多型是什麼

相關問題 & 資訊整理

多型是什麼

構成多型的條件有三項,如下: 1. ... 有重寫(override) 父類方法3. 父類引用指向子類物件當三個條件滿足,當你調父類中被重寫的方法時,實際是在調., 此題為面試筆試時的常考題,也是基本題。 多載(Overload)指在一個類別(class)中,定義多個名稱相同,但參數(Parameter)不同的方法(Method)。,因為要開始理解多型(Polymorphism),必須先知道你操作的物件是「哪一種」東西! 來看實際的例子,以下的程式碼片段,相信你現在沒有問題地看懂,而且知道可以 ... ,在多型與is-a 關係曾試著當編譯器,判斷哪些繼承多型語法可以通過編譯,加入扮演(Cast)語法的目的又是為何,以及哪些情況下,執行時期會扮演失敗,哪些又可扮演 ... , 多型(Polymorphism). 多型是又一個重要的基本概念,上面說到了,它是物件導向的三個基本特徵之一。究竟什麼是多型呢?我們先看看下面的例子, ..., 方法在Ruby中預設是public,而內部需要隱藏的方法,則使用private隱藏起來,這表示你只能使用object中的public method來呼叫他,換句話說, ..., 多型(Polymorphism) 代表能夠在執行階段,物件能夠依照不同情況變換資料型態,換句話說,多型是指一個物件參考可以在不同環境下,扮演不同 ...,變數多型是指:基本類型的變數(對於C++是參照或指標)可以被賦值基本類型物件,也可以被賦值衍生類型的物件。函式多型是指,相同的函式呼叫介面(函式名與實參表 ... ,多型操作是物件導向上一個重要的特性,這個小節會介紹多型的觀念,以及「抽象類別」(Abstract)與「介面」(Interface)應用的幾個實例。 8.2.1 多型導論. 先來解釋一下這 ... ,在程式設計中,「繼承」(Inheritance)是一把雙面刃,用的好的話可讓整個程式架構具有相當的彈性,用不好的話整個程式會難以維護與修改。「多型」機制本身並不 ...

相關軟體 Java Development Kit 資訊

Java Development Kit
Java Development Kit(也叫 JDK)是一個非常專業的跨平台的 SDK 平台,由 Oracle 公司定期提供支持。為了提供來自世界各地的 Java SE,Java EE 和 Java ME 平台的開發人員的具體實現。由於其強大的開發支持,該 SDK 包代表了最廣泛和最廣泛使用的 Java SDK 平台,用於創建各種規模的企業項目和開源項目。 Java Development Ki... Java Development Kit 軟體介紹

多型是什麼 相關參考資料
多型( polymorphism) @ Cedric's 學習備忘錄:: 痞客邦::

構成多型的條件有三項,如下: 1. ... 有重寫(override) 父類方法3. 父類引用指向子類物件當三個條件滿足,當你調父類中被重寫的方法時,實際是在調.

https://ced425.pixnet.net

Java 什麼是多載(Overload), 覆寫(Override), 多型 - 菜鳥工程師 ...

此題為面試筆試時的常考題,也是基本題。 多載(Overload)指在一個類別(class)中,定義多個名稱相同,但參數(Parameter)不同的方法(Method)。

https://matthung0807.blogspot.

多型與is-a 關係 - OpenHome.cc

因為要開始理解多型(Polymorphism),必須先知道你操作的物件是「哪一種」東西! 來看實際的例子,以下的程式碼片段,相信你現在沒有問題地看懂,而且知道可以 ...

https://openhome.cc

行為的多型 - OpenHome.cc

在多型與is-a 關係曾試著當編譯器,判斷哪些繼承多型語法可以通過編譯,加入扮演(Cast)語法的目的又是為何,以及哪些情況下,執行時期會扮演失敗,哪些又可扮演 ...

https://openhome.cc

Java中繼承、多型、過載和重寫介紹| 程式前沿

多型(Polymorphism). 多型是又一個重要的基本概念,上面說到了,它是物件導向的三個基本特徵之一。究竟什麼是多型呢?我們先看看下面的例子, ...

https://codertw.com

什麼是物件導向中的封裝、繼承和多型特性? - W-Learning ...

方法在Ruby中預設是public,而內部需要隱藏的方法,則使用private隱藏起來,這表示你只能使用object中的public method來呼叫他,換句話說, ...

https://medium.com

5. 什麼是多型- 國立中山大學程式諮詢網 - Google Sites

多型(Polymorphism) 代表能夠在執行階段,物件能夠依照不同情況變換資料型態,換句話說,多型是指一個物件參考可以在不同環境下,扮演不同 ...

https://sites.google.com

多型(電腦科學) - 維基百科,自由的百科全書 - Wikipedia

變數多型是指:基本類型的變數(對於C++是參照或指標)可以被賦值基本類型物件,也可以被賦值衍生類型的物件。函式多型是指,相同的函式呼叫介面(函式名與實參表 ...

https://zh.wikipedia.org

多型(Polymorphism) | Java SE 6 技術手冊 - caterpillar

多型操作是物件導向上一個重要的特性,這個小節會介紹多型的觀念,以及「抽象類別」(Abstract)與「介面」(Interface)應用的幾個實例。 8.2.1 多型導論. 先來解釋一下這 ...

https://caterpillar.gitbooks.i

繼承(Inheritance)、多型(Polymorphism) | Java SE 6 技術手冊

在程式設計中,「繼承」(Inheritance)是一把雙面刃,用的好的話可讓整個程式架構具有相當的彈性,用不好的話整個程式會難以維護與修改。「多型」機制本身並不 ...

https://caterpillar.gitbooks.i